Interesting choice of words - Dear Sentinel. Diversity - an Innovation? I guess you and I went to different madrasas

Diversity exists because of the Will of Allah. And, He wants us to Cherish Diversity and not REVILE it. Pls refer to [49:13] as follows and a Caution from Allah lest anyone thinks that they are the other person’s keeper - refer to aya [6:107] listed below:

Translation: Yusufali
[al-Hujurat 49:13] O mankind! We created you from a single (pair) of a male and a female, and made you into nations and tribes, that ye may know each other (not that ye may despise (each other). Verily the most honoured of you in the sight of God is (he who is) the most righteous of you. And God has full knowledge and is well acquainted (with all things).

[al-An`am 6:107] If it had been God’s plan, they would not have taken false gods: but We made thee not one to watch over their doings, nor art thou set over them to dispose of their affairs.

end of quote

If one reads ayath 49:13 or:
"…We created you from a single (pair) of a male and a female, and made you into nations and tribes, that ye may know each other (not that ye may despise (each other). Verily the most honoured of you in the sight of God is (he who is) the most righteous of you…"

Is Allah condemning Diversity?
Instead - Allah is clearly saying that the most honoured is the one who does not despise, rather cherish diversity.

Also, just in case that one wishes to IMPOSE their own interpretation to the notion of Allah’s Diversity, Allah has this CAUTION :

[al-An`am 6:107] If it had been God’s plan, they would not have taken false gods: but We made thee not one to watch over their doings, nor art thou set over them to dispose of their affairs.

I think in its proper context (given above), Sentinel is correct. Islam is anything but nationalistic - as a universal creed it does not limit itself to race, ethnicity, tribal boundaries etc, because those parameters do not define “Muslim”. Islam acknowledges these “boundries” but does not in away limit itself with regards to them. “Arab is equal (neither superior nor inferior) to the Ajam”
